Misconception: Oral Surgery Is Constantly Agonizing



You might think that oral surgery always includes pain, but that's merely not real. As opposed to popular belief, oral surgery procedures aren't always unpleasant experiences. Thanks to developments in anesthetic and sedation techniques, dental cosmetic surgeons are able to make sure that people are comfortable and pain-free throughout the whole treatment.

Prior to the surgical treatment starts, you'll be given anesthesia, which numbs the area being dealt with and stops you from really feeling any type of pain. In addition, if you experience any type of anxiousness or worry, your dental cosmetic surgeon can carry out sedation to aid you unwind and feel even more secure.

Whether you're obtaining a tooth extraction, dental implant, or jaw surgical treatment, rest assured that dental surgery can be a pain-free and comfy experience.

Misconception: Oral Surgery Is Only for Emergencies



As opposed to common belief, oral surgery isn't limited to emergency situation situations.

While it's true that dental surgery can be necessary in cases of serious injury or sudden discomfort, it's additionally frequently utilized for planned procedures that boost the overall health and wellness and feature of your mouth.

For instance, if you have actually misaligned jaws or teeth that don't fit correctly, dental surgery can deal with these issues and prevent future troubles.

Furthermore, oral surgery can be done to get rid of influenced wisdom teeth, treat gum tissue condition, or area oral implants.

By resolving these concerns prior to they end up being emergency situations, dental surgery can assist keep your dental health and wellness and stop more severe difficulties down the line.

Misconception: Recovery From Dental Surgery Takes a Long Period Of Time



If you have undertaken oral surgery, you may be shocked to learn that the misconception regarding recovery taking a long time isn't necessarily real. While it holds true that some dental surgeries may need a longer recuperation duration, such as complex treatments like jaw realignment or several extractions, numerous regular dental surgeries have a fairly quick recuperation time.

For instance, treatments such as wisdom tooth extraction or dental implant positioning often have a shorter recovery time, typically ranging from a couple of days to a couple of weeks. Variables such as your general health and wellness, the complexity of the surgical procedure, and how well you comply with post-operative directions can likewise affect the size of your recovery.

It is very important to speak with your oral specialist to get an accurate quote of your specific recuperation time.

Misconception: Dental Surgery Is Not Needed forever Oral Wellness



Dental surgery plays an essential function in keeping great oral health and wellness. Unlike the popular myth, it isn't simply a cosmetic treatment or an unnecessary high-end. Below's why oral surgery is needed for your dental wellness:

- Extraction of impacted knowledge teeth: Removing influenced knowledge teeth prevents overcrowding, infection, and prospective damages to adjacent teeth.

- Treatment of oral infections: Oral surgery can help treat extreme gum tissue infections, abscesses, and other oral infections that can result in significant health difficulties if left unattended.

- Corrective jaw surgical treatment: Jaw misalignment can create problem in consuming, speech problems, and can even cause temporomandibular joint (TMJ) problem. Oral surgery can deal with these issues.

- Dental implants: Oral surgery is needed for putting dental implants, which are the best option for replacing missing teeth.

- Therapy of oral cancer: Oral surgery is usually needed for the elimination of cancerous lumps and the reconstruction of cells influenced by dental cancer.

Don't succumb to the misconception that dental surgery is unnecessary. It's a vital part of preserving good oral health and wellness and avoiding further problems.
